The lipid nanoparticles market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$1.21 billion in 2025 to $1.42 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 16.9%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to advancements in nanotechnology research, increasing pharmaceutical R&D investments, early adoption of lipid-based delivery systems, growing academic research on nanoparticles, rising demand for targeted drug delivery.

The lipid nanoparticles market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$2.41 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 14.2%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to expansion of gene and mrna therapies, increasing demand for advanced drug delivery platforms, rising focus on precision medicine, growth in biopharmaceutical pipelines, increasing collaborations between industry and research institutes. Major trends in the forecast period include growing adoption of lipid nanoparticles in drug delivery, increasing use of lnps in nucleic acid therapeutics, rising focus on enhanced drug stability and bioavailability, expansion of lipid nanoparticles in research applications, growing demand for scalable and reproducible lnp formulations.

The increasing prevalence of chronic diseases is driving the growth of the lipid nanoparticles (LNPs) market. Chronic diseases are conditions that persist over a long period, typically longer than three months, and include illnesses such as diabetes, hypertension, and other related disorders. The rates of chronic diseases are rising due to factors such as unhealthy behaviors, aging populations, lifestyle choices, tobacco use, poor nutrition, lack of physical activity, and excessive alcohol consumption. Lipid nanoparticles (LNPs) provide an effective approach to managing chronic diseases because of their ability to enhance the efficacy of mRNA therapeutics and vaccines. LNPs improve the treatment options for various chronic conditions, offering the potential for more effective management and better patient outcomes. For example, in June 2024, the National Health Service (NHS), a UK-based government organization, reported that in 2023, over half a million (549,000) additional individuals in England were identified at risk of developing type 2 diabetes, bringing the total number of people with non-diabetic hyperglycemia, or pre-diabetes, registered with a GP to 3,615,330. This marked a notable increase from 3,065,825 in 2022, reflecting a rise of nearly 20%. Consequently, the growing prevalence of chronic diseases is fueling the expansion of the lipid nanoparticle market.

Major companies operating in the lipid nanoparticles (LNPs) market are developing circular RNA (circRNA) and lipid nanoparticle (LNP) formulations to strengthen their competitive position. The advancement of circular RNA (circRNA) and lipid nanoparticle (LNP) formulations provides a broader range of RNA formats, including circRNA, a single-stranded RNA that forms a covalently closed loop. For example, in September 2023, GenScript Biotech, a US-based life sciences company, expanded its reagent services to incorporate circular RNA (circRNA) and lipid nanoparticle (LNP) formulations. These new services reflect GenScript's commitment to supporting protein replacement therapies as well as gene and cell therapy and are immediately available through GenScript's contract-manufactured reagent services. CircRNA offers several benefits over conventional linear RNA, including greater stability, slower degradation, and the ability to achieve desired therapeutic protein levels at lower dosages.

In August 2025, AbbVie Inc., a US-based biopharmaceutical company, acquired Capstan Therapeutics, Inc. for an undisclosed amount. Through this acquisition, AbbVie aims to strengthen its immunology pipeline by integrating Capstan’s in vivo targeted lipid nanoparticle (tLNP) platform and its lead therapy candidate CPTX2309, a first-in-class anti-CD19 CAR T therapy, to achieve durable, drug-free remission in B cell-mediated autoimmune diseases. Capstan Therapeutics Inc., a US-based biotechnology company, focuses on developing RNA delivery (mRNA) technologies to program specific immune cells in vivo.

Tariffs have impacted the lipid nanoparticles market by increasing costs associated with imported raw lipids, specialized reagents, and advanced manufacturing equipment. These effects are more pronounced across therapeutic applications and large-scale production of nano-structured lipid carriers, particularly in regions such as Asia-Pacific and Europe that rely on global supply chains. P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ies face higher production and development costs due to tariff pressures. However, tariffs have also encouraged local sourcing, domestic manufacturing capabilities, and supply chain diversification, supporting long-term market stability.

Lipid nanoparticles (LNPs) are a type of nanoparticle primarily made up of lipids, which are fatty substances that form essential components of cell membranes. These nanoparticles usually consist of a lipid bilayer or a solid lipid matrix and are distinguished by their small size, typically ranging from 10 to 1000 nanometers in diameter.

The main categories of lipid nanoparticles include nanostructured lipid carriers (NLCs), solid lipid nanoparticles (SLNs), and others. Nanostructured lipid carriers (NLCs) are small structures composed of fats that can encapsulate drugs or nutrients. They are utilized in a variety of applications such as research and therapeutics and are employed by various end users including p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ies, academic and research institutions, and others.
